Understanding Lifting Beams and Spreader Beams
Wiki Article
The hoisting girder and the distributing girder are vital components within heavy load hoisting tasks. Typically , a lifting bar acts as a robust framework designed to spread a burden among multiple raising points , decreasing pressure on separate hoisting areas and stopping damage to the load or a raising apparatus. Alternatively, the spreader girder primarily serves to widen a distance between lifting locations , enhancing equilibrium and enabling a secure shift of oversized items .

Safe Hoisting Procedures with Lifting Girders
Employing overhead beams safely requires thorough planning and adherence to standard procedures . Always verify the beam’s state before each lift, checking for wear. Ensure the load is tightly balanced on the girder and that the lifting machinery , such as the crane , has an adequate limit for the total burden. Never go beyond the structure's designated capacity, and remember to account for the inclination of the operation, as this will affect the pressures on the structure. Follow producer's instructions and local rules .

A Comprehensive Guide to Spreader Beam Uses
Spreader spreaders are critical lifting devices used in numerous fields, particularly where large loads need to be moved . Their key role is to distribute the weight across several lifting points , effectively reducing stress on individual attachment points. Common instances include lifting pre-fabricated structures , substantial machinery, and generator components . Proper selection of the suitable spreader beam layout and controlled handling procedures are crucial for avoiding mishaps and guaranteeing a reliable lifting operation .
